Buildings.HeatTransfer.Data.Shades.Generic
Extends from Modelica.Icons.Record (Icon for records).
| Type | Name | Default | Description |
|---|---|---|---|
| TransmissionCoefficient | tauSol_a | 0.1 | Solar transmissivity of shade surface a (surface that faces the outside or the room) [1] |
| TransmissionCoefficient | tauSol_b | 0.1 | Solar transmissivity of shade surface b (surface that faces the glass) [1] |
| ReflectionCoefficient | rhoSol_a | 0.8 | Solar reflection coefficient of shade surface a (surface that faces the outside or the room) [1] |
| ReflectionCoefficient | rhoSol_b | 0.8 | Solar reflection coefficient of shade surface b (surface that faces the glass) [1] |
| Emissivity | absIR_a | 0.84 | Infrared absorptivity of surface a (surface that faces the outside or the room) [1] |
| Emissivity | absIR_b | 0.84 | Infrared absorptivity of surface b (surface that faces the glass) [1] |
| TransmissionCoefficient | tauIR_a | 0 | Infrared transmissivity of surface a (surface that faces the outside or the room) [1] |
| TransmissionCoefficient | tauIR_b | 0 | Infrared transmissivity of surface b (surface that faces the glass) [1] |
record Generic "Thermal properties of window shades"
extends Modelica.Icons.Record;
parameter Modelica.SIunits.TransmissionCoefficient tauSol_a=0.1
"Solar transmissivity of shade surface a (surface that faces the outside or the room)";
parameter Modelica.SIunits.TransmissionCoefficient tauSol_b=0.1
"Solar transmissivity of shade surface b (surface that faces the glass)";
parameter Modelica.SIunits.ReflectionCoefficient rhoSol_a=0.8
"Solar reflection coefficient of shade surface a (surface that faces the outside or the room)";
parameter Modelica.SIunits.ReflectionCoefficient rhoSol_b=0.8
"Solar reflection coefficient of shade surface b (surface that faces the glass)";
parameter Modelica.SIunits.Emissivity absIR_a=0.84
"Infrared absorptivity of surface a (surface that faces the outside or the room)";
parameter Modelica.SIunits.Emissivity absIR_b=0.84
"Infrared absorptivity of surface b (surface that faces the glass)";
parameter Modelica.SIunits.TransmissionCoefficient tauIR_a=0
"Infrared transmissivity of surface a (surface that faces the outside or the room)";
parameter Modelica.SIunits.TransmissionCoefficient tauIR_b=0
"Infrared transmissivity of surface b (surface that faces the glass)";
end Generic;
